Transaction ff305028ebb82e19c23c7ef6c309d650604cbf29e3edf244c5f4080768a74f41

1 Input
2 Outputs
  • ff305028ebb82e19c23c7ef6c309d650604cbf29e3edf244c5f4080768a74f41:0
  • value  1690863
    address  13uX7nnsU1RYjGHwEoNNzQ3sayH3XnX2U1
  • ff305028ebb82e19c23c7ef6c309d650604cbf29e3edf244c5f4080768a74f41:1
  • value  44420541
    address  37ZBq5BWJruTGKNpwKee8wsUmzp2eb2TpR